What is 50/63 Divided By 1/9

Answer: 5063÷19\frac{50}{63}\div\frac{1}{9} = 507\frac{50}{7}

Solving 5063÷19\frac{50}{63}\div\frac{1}{9}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

5063÷19=5063×91\frac{50}{63} \div \frac{1}{9} = \frac{50}{63} \times \frac{9}{1}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 50×9=45050 \times 9 = 450
  • Multiply the Denominators: 63×1=6363 \times 1 = 63
  • Form the New Fraction: 5063×19=45063\frac{50}{63} \times \frac{1}{9} = \frac{450}{63}

Let's Simplify 45063\frac{450}{63}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 450450 and 6363. The GCD of 450450 and 6363 is 99.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:450÷963÷9=507\frac{450 \div 9}{63 \div 9} = \frac{50}{7}

Answer 5063÷19=507\frac{50}{63}\div\frac{1}{9} = \frac{50}{7}
